Output 64f8b78c0ca9a788010c66991a19bef125b7bee5107e3c9771785f9fbf44e617:115

value
84657632
script pubkey
OP_0 OP_PUSHBYTES_20 d6b35e73529659dc3d62b3bd3e62e92d2b2df946
address
bc1q66e4uu6jjevac0tzkw7nuchf954jm72x9tjk75
transaction
64f8b78c0ca9a788010c66991a19bef125b7bee5107e3c9771785f9fbf44e617